Instal dan atur KVM di Ubuntu 20.04 FOSSA FOSSA Linux

Instal dan atur KVM di Ubuntu 20.04 FOSSA FOSSA Linux

KVM IS Mesin virtual berbasis kernel. Ini adalah modul yang dibangun langsung ke dalam kernel Linux yang memungkinkan sistem operasi untuk bertindak sebagai hypervisor. Meskipun beberapa orang mungkin lebih suka solusi pihak ketiga seperti VirtualBox, tidak perlu menginstal perangkat lunak tambahan karena kernel Linux sudah memberi kita alat yang diperlukan yang kita butuhkan untuk membuat mesin virtual.

KVM memerlukan sedikit konfigurasi jika Anda ingin beberapa kenyamanan seperti manajer grafis atau kemampuan untuk memungkinkan tamu VM masuk dari jaringan Anda - tetapi kami akan membahasnya di panduan ini. Setelah berjalan dan berjalan, Anda akan menemukan bahwa KVM memberikan pengalaman yang paling stabil dan mulus untuk kebutuhan virtualisasi Anda di Linux.

Dalam tutorial ini Anda akan belajar:

  • Cara menginstal utilitas kvm yang diperlukan di ubuntu 20.04
  • Cara Menginstal dan Mengkonfigurasi Virt-Manager
  • Cara Mengkonfigurasi Antarmuka Jaringan Untuk Koneksi Jembatan
  • Cara membuat mesin virtual baru
Membuat VM baru di Virt-Manager Persyaratan Perangkat Lunak dan Konvensi Baris Perintah Linux
Kategori Persyaratan, konvensi atau versi perangkat lunak yang digunakan
Sistem Ubuntu 20 terpasang atau ditingkatkan.04 FOSSA FOCAL
Perangkat lunak KVM, Virt-Manager
Lainnya Akses istimewa ke sistem Linux Anda sebagai root atau melalui sudo memerintah.
Konvensi # - mensyaratkan perintah linux yang diberikan untuk dieksekusi dengan hak istimewa root baik secara langsung sebagai pengguna root atau dengan menggunakan sudo memerintah
$ - mensyaratkan perintah Linux yang diberikan untuk dieksekusi sebagai pengguna biasa

Instal Paket KVM



Meskipun KVM adalah modul yang dibangun ke dalam kernel Linux itu sendiri, itu tidak berarti bahwa semua paket yang diperlukan termasuk dalam pemasangan Ubuntu Anda secara default. Anda membutuhkan beberapa untuk memulai, dan mereka dapat diinstal dengan perintah ini di terminal:

$ sudo apt instal qemu-kvm libvirt-clients libvirt-daemon-system bridge-utils virt-manager 

Konfigurasikan jembatan jaringan

Agar mesin virtual Anda untuk mengakses antarmuka jaringan Anda dan ditetapkan alamat IP mereka sendiri, kami perlu mengkonfigurasi jaringan yang dijembatani di sistem kami.

Pertama, jalankan perintah Linux berikut untuk mengetahui nama antarmuka jaringan Anda yang telah ditetapkan. Mengetahui ini akan memungkinkan kami untuk melakukan konfigurasi tambahan nanti.

$ ip a 
Tentukan nama antarmuka jaringan

Dalam kasus kami, antarmuka jaringan dipanggil ENP0S3. Milikmu kemungkinan akan dinamai dengan sangat mirip.

Untuk memberi tahu Ubuntu bahwa kami ingin koneksi kami dijembatani, kami perlu mengedit file konfigurasi antarmuka jaringan. Melakukan ini tidak akan berdampak negatif pada koneksi Anda sama sekali. Itu hanya akan memungkinkan koneksi itu dibagikan dengan VMS.

Menggunakan nano Atau editor teks favorit Anda untuk membuka file berikut:

$ sudo nano/etc/jaringan/antarmuka 

Saat pertama kali membuka file ini, itu mungkin kosong atau hanya berisi beberapa baris. Antarmuka jembatan Anda dipanggil Br0, Jadi tambahkan baris berikut untuk antarmuka yang muncul secara default:

Auto BR0 

Di bawah baris ini, tambahkan baris berikut untuk antarmuka jaringan Anda saat ini (yang dinamai kami ditentukan sebelumnya).

iface enp0s3 inet manual 

Selanjutnya, Anda dapat menambahkan informasi jembatan. Baris -baris ini memberi tahu Ubuntu bahwa jembatan Anda akan menggunakan DHCP untuk penugasan alamat IP otomatis, dan jembatan Anda akan mengelola antarmuka Anda saat ini.

iface br0 inet dhcp bridge_ports enp0s3 

Ini adalah bagaimana file Anda harus terlihat begitu semua perubahan telah diterapkan (jika Anda juga memiliki beberapa baris yang sudah ada, tidak apa -apa untuk memilikinya juga):

File Konfigurasi Antarmuka Jaringan

Simpan perubahan Anda dan keluar dari file.

Tambahkan pengguna Anda ke grup

Untuk mengelola mesin virtual Anda tanpa hak istimewa root, pengguna Anda perlu menjadi bagian dari dua grup pengguna. Jalankan perintah berikut untuk menambahkan pengguna Anda ke grup yang sesuai (mengganti user1 dengan nama pengguna Anda):

$ sudo adduser user1 libvirt $ sudo adduser user1 libvirt-qemu 

Setelah selesai, Anda harus me -restart sistem Anda untuk memastikan bahwa semua perubahan yang dilakukan pada pengguna dan konfigurasi jaringan Anda memiliki kesempatan untuk berlaku.

Membuat VM

Saat Ubuntu Boots Back Up, Anda dapat membuka Virt-Manager dari peluncur aplikasi. Meskipun mungkin tidak terlihat banyak, jendela ini akan memberi kita semua yang kita butuhkan untuk mengelola VM kita.

Untuk mulai membuat VM baru, klik ikon kiri atas, yang terlihat seperti layar komputer yang mengkilap.

Buat VM baru

Mesin virtual baru Anda akan membutuhkan sistem operasi. Kemungkinan besar Anda akan menginstal dari .file iso, jadi pilih opsi ini di jendela pertama. Jika Anda masih membutuhkan gambar sistem operasi, pergilah ke Ubuntu 20.04 Unduh dan unduh satu secara gratis.

Pilih Sumber Instalasi

Jelajahi file instalasi Anda dan pilih.

Telusuri media instalasi

Anda juga perlu memberi tahu Virt-Manager sistem operasi apa yang Anda coba instal, jika tidak secara otomatis menentukannya.

Isi informasi OS

Di layar berikutnya, alokasikan sejumlah besar sumber daya CPU dan memori ke mesin virtual baru Anda. Berhati -hatilah untuk tidak memberikan terlalu banyak.

CPU dan alokasi memori

Layar berikutnya akan bertanya tentang ukuran hard drive. Sekali lagi, masukkan jumlah yang masuk akal - mesin virtual mungkin tidak membutuhkan banyak.

Alokasi penyimpanan

Berikan nama mesin virtual Anda dan selesaikan perubahan Anda di layar berikutnya. Klik 'Selesai' saat Anda siap untuk memulai instalasi.

Finalisasi Pengaturan Mesin Virtual

Setelah mengklik selesai, sistem operasi akan menginstal seperti biasanya di komputer fisik. Setelah selesai, Anda dapat terus menggunakan aplikasi Virt-Manager untuk mengelola mesin virtual Anda, termasuk menyalakan dan mematikannya.

Kesimpulan

Dalam artikel ini, kami belajar cara menggunakan KVM dan Virt-Manager untuk menginstal dan mengelola mesin virtual di Ubuntu 20.04 FOSSA FOCAL. Kami juga melihat cara mengkonfigurasi antarmuka jaringan untuk koneksi yang dijembatani antara mesin host dan sistem operasi tamu.

KVM adalah alat yang sangat kuat, dan dipasangkan dengan virt-manager membuat manajemen yang ramping dan mudah dari beberapa mesin virtual. Sekarang KVM diatur, Anda akan memiliki akses ke hampir semua sistem operasi dalam bentuk tervirtualisasi, langsung dari desktop Ubuntu Anda.

Tutorial Linux Terkait:

  • Hal -hal yang harus diinstal pada ubuntu 20.04
  • Hal -hal yang harus dilakukan setelah menginstal ubuntu 20.04 FOSSA FOSSA Linux
  • Ubuntu 20.04 trik dan hal -hal yang mungkin tidak Anda ketahui
  • Ubuntu 20.04 Panduan
  • Cara menginstal ubuntu 20.04 di VirtualBox
  • Instal Manjaro di VirtualBox
  • Ubuntu 20.04 Hadoop
  • Hal -hal yang harus diinstal pada Ubuntu 22.04
  • 8 Lingkungan Desktop Ubuntu Terbaik (20.04 FOSSA FOCAL…
  • Pengantar Otomatisasi Linux, Alat dan Teknik